好的,这里是twitter API,
http://search.twitter.com/search.atom?q=perkytweets
任何人都可以给我有关如何使用Meteor调用此API或链接的任何提示吗
更新::
这是我尝试过的代码,但未显示任何响应
if (Meteor.isClient) {
Template.hello.greeting = function () {
return "Welcome to HelloWorld";
};
Template.hello.events({
'click input' : function () {
checkTwitter();
}
});
Meteor.methods({checkTwitter: function () {
this.unblock();
var result = Meteor.http.call("GET", "http://search.twitter.com/search.atom?q=perkytweets");
alert(result.statusCode);
}});
}
if (Meteor.isServer) {
Meteor.startup(function () {
});
}
您要定义checkTwitter Meteor.method
内部 客户范围的块。因为您不能从客户端调用跨域(除非使用jsonp),所以您必须将此块放在一个Meteor.isServer
块中。
顺便说一句,每个文档,在客户端Meteor.method
的checkTwitter功能仅仅是一个
存根 服务器端方法。您将需要查看文档,以获取有关服务器端和客户端如何Meteor.methods
协同工作的完整说明。
这是http调用的工作示例:
if (Meteor.isServer) {
Meteor.methods({
checkTwitter: function () {
this.unblock();
return Meteor.http.call("GET", "http://search.twitter.com/search.json?q=perkytweets");
}
});
}
//invoke the server method
if (Meteor.isClient) {
Meteor.call("checkTwitter", function(error, results) {
console.log(results.content); //results.data should be a JSON object
});
}
我假设有很多情况需要调用基于值列表的外部RESTful服务。 现在对于这些productId中的每一个,我想并行调用一个外部endpoint。大致如下: 你会如何转换这个 到 当所有通话成功完成时。 一个人如何使用可完成的未来来实现这一点? 我想我要问的是,如何等待所有调用完成,然后以集合的形式获得结果。
我使用postman测试了一个API。使用postman,我设法生成了一个令牌。 从postman那里,我通过一个get请求,使用以下内容和以下详细信息获取了用户的所有数据: 在授权类型下,我选择了“无记名令牌”并将令牌粘贴在其各自的字段中。 当我单击发送时,我得到了一个用户数据的成功响应。 在PHP中,如何在PHP函数中执行相同的api调用(使用id、电子邮件和令牌)? 我试过这个: 但当我查看
基础连接已关闭:发送时发生意外错误。(身份验证失败,因为远程方已关闭传输流。)
我对Spring的靴子是陌生的,在它们到来的时候学习。我有一个关于并行API调用的快速问题。 我有一个ID数组,我将把它附加到第三方APIendpoint,发出GET请求,聚合数据,并在所有3000个调用完成后从中生成一个文件。 这里的问题是Array的大小为3000,即我预计会进行3000次调用。我觉得使用for循环并迭代超过3000次没有任何意义,而且效率较低。 有谁能给我建议一个最好、最有效
我希望使用spring WebFlux以反应的方式流式传输一个文件。 我的endpoint应该是什么样子更具体的对象的类型是什么?
问题内容: 我正在尝试对Google MapsGeocoding网络服务进行jQuery调用,但这由于跨域安全性问题而无法使用。 我还没能在网上找到答案,但是我已经读了一些有关Google Javascript API或JSONP的文章,但到目前为止还没有明确的答案… 有人能启发我吗? 谢谢! 问题答案: 当Google Maps提供功能齐全的JavaScript客户端地理编码API时,使用服务器